Type-Level Thinking: Safer APIs and Invariants in Haskell and F#
What if your compiler could catch entire categories of bugs before your code ever runs?
In Type-Level Thinking, you’ll discover how to turn advanced type systems into practical tools for building bulletproof software. This hands-on, insight-driven guide shows you how to encode business rules, invariants, and domain constraints directly into the type system—so invalid states become unrepresentable and runtime errors become compile-time guarantees.
Focusing on Haskell and F#, the book bridges theory and real-world engineering. You’ll move beyond basic algebraic data types into powerful techniques such as:
Designing APIs that enforce correctness by construction
Encoding domain rules with phantom types and smart constructors
Leveraging GADTs and type-level programming in Haskell
Using F#’s discriminated unions and units of measure for stronger models
Eliminating whole classes of bugs through expressive type design
Refactoring legacy code into safer, intention-revealing systems
Through clear explanations, practical examples, and progressive case studies, you’ll learn to think in types—not just use them. Whether you’re designing financial systems, distributed services, or domain-driven applications, you’ll see how type-level techniques reduce complexity, improve maintainability, and make your APIs self-documenting.
